Web16 mrt. 2024 · While the eggs (nits) cannot move, lice can walk from one head to another. The more hair available for lice transfer, the more likely this transfer is. So it's more common in kids with longer hair, and more likely if hair isn't tied up. Head lice don't jump and they don't fly, so you do have to have hair-to-hair contact. Web21 jan. 2024 · Head lice live in cycles of about 28 days. They progress from eggs to nymphs to adult lice. Without treatment, this cycle can repeat every 3 weeks. Was this helpful? WebBody lice nits may take 1–2 weeks to hatch. Nymph: A nymph is an immature louse that hatches from the nit (egg). A nymph looks like an adult body louse, but is smaller. Nymphs mature into adults about 9–12 days after hatching. To live, the nymph must feed on blood.
